前提・実現したいこと
データベース関数を用いてデータベースに接続した際、
該当ソースコードに書かれてある記述の場合、
データベースからの切断「$dbh=null」は必要ないのか知りたい。
該当のソースコード
<?php function connectDb() { $dsn = "mysql:dbname=データベース名;host=localhost;charset=utf8"; $user = "ユーザ名"; $password ="パスワード"; try{ $dbh = new PDO($dsn,$user,$password); $dbh->setAttribute(PDO::ATTR_ERRMODE,PFO::ERRMODE_EXCEPTION); //データベースで切断のために、ここに「$dbh=null」は必要ではないのか。 }catch(PDOException $e){ exit("データベース接続エラー:{$e->getMessage()"); } return $dbh; }
補足情報(FW/ツールのバージョンなど)
よろしくお願いします。